Greyhounds Slip One Spot Outside USILA Top 10
BALTIMORE - The UIndy men's lacrosse team slipped one spot to No. 11 in the latest USILA national poll, released Monday afternoon. The Greyhounds dominated William Jewell in their lone contest of the week, improving to 9-3 on the season and 2-1 in GLVC action. Justin Williams leads the team with 36 points, while Owain Braddock has a team-best 25 goals. In net, KC Carlson has been on fire this season, recording a .541 save percentage with 105 stops in 12 games.
